George Russell has disagreed with Lewis Hamilton’s claim that Mercedes should have listened to his feedback when designing the W14 car, insisting that drivers do not have much of a say in the way they are built.

The 25-year-old responded after Hamilton’s criticism of the team earlier this year, saying: “Every single race and every time we drive on track, we’re giving our feedback on what we need from the car and what needs to be improved,” he said via Motorsport Week.

“And we’ll go back – every driver does more or less on the simulator, and that is a really useful tool to develop these cars. I’m trying to put as much effort as possible on the sim to help in that regard.

“But at the end of the day, it comes down to the bright and intelligent designers and engineers to deliver the goods with the direction that between Lewis and I, and the main engineers, have set out and what we need to deliver.”
